Archbishop welcomes Government announcement on credit unions
The Archbishop of Canterbury, Dr Rowan Williams, has welcomed an announcement by the Treasury that legislation will be brought forward to assist Credit Unions.

 

Archbishop - protect the poorest from the effects of economic downturn
The Archbishop of Canterbury, Dr Rowan Williams, has called on the Government to do more to protect the poorest and most vulnerable from the likely consequences of an economic downturn.

 

Booklet explains how ethical household spending could reduce mortgage payments and even eliminate global poverty
Applying Christian principles to handling money could reduce the UK’s consumer debt crisis, keep mortgage payments down, and eliminate global poverty, according to a new booklet by a leading Church of England specialist on personal finance and giving.
